WebJul 31, 2024 · Head Start is a federal program that promotes the school readiness of children ages birth to five from low-income families by enhancing their cognitive, social and emotional development. WebHead Start Head Start and Early Head Start are child development programs, serving children from birth to age five, expectant mothers and families. The overall goal of Head Start is to increase the social ability of children in low-income families and children with disabilities, and improve the chances of success in school.

WebMay 18, 2024 · Head Start is a federal program for preschool children three to five years of age in low-income families. Its aim is to prepare children for success in school through an early learning program. The Head Start program is managed by local nonprofit organizations in almost every county in the country.

WebDec 29, 2024 · The Head Start Approach to School Readiness means that children are ready for school , families are ready to support their children's learning, and schools are ready for children.
